8 kumpf 1.96 2. (Roger Kumpf - HP) 5 Apr 2002 - Modified the CIMOperationResponseMessage
9 class and its subclasses to contain a CIMException instead of a
10 CIMStatusCode and String description. This allows extra information in
11 a CIMException, such as file name and line number, to be carried
12 internally throughout the system.
13
14 This change creates a single place where CIMExceptions are converted
15 to an error code and description to be written out in XML. This
16 single place controls the ability to tune what gets included in the
17 error description, as well as providing a convenient place to trace
18 errors that get returned to clients. In particular, client applications
19 currently see messages that contain redundant error code information,
20 such as:
21
22 CIM_ERR_INVALID_PARAMETER: One or more parameter values passed
23 to the method were invalid: "CIM_ERR_INVALID_PARAMETER: One
24 or more parameter values passed to the method were invalid:
25 "Unrecognized parameter "Bogus"""
26
27 The CIMOperationResponseMessage change will allow the redundant
28 information to be eliminated from the messages.

201 Version 1.07 working towards 1.1 - Started 4 Feb 2002
202 Started just before cutover to the new dispatcher, etc.
203 TAG: VERSION_1_07
204
205 1. KS - Updated pegsusversion to 1.07 and tagged file.
206
|
207 sage 1.60 2. (Markus Mueller) 05 Feb 2002 - AIX support.
|
208 karl 1.59
|
209 kumpf 1.67 3. (Sushma Fernandes - HP) 13 Feb 2002 Implemented FileSystemPropertyOwner
210 class to support PEGASUS_HOME dependent properties like Repository
211 location, Provider location and Consumer location.
212 The default location for these properties continue to be the same
213 as before. Added support to the Config Manager to own the
214 Pegasus Home variable and implemented method (getHomedPath) to
215 return absolute paths based from Pegasus Home.
216
217 For more information look in to the following files:
218 pegasus/src/Pegasus/Config/ConfigManager.h
219 pegasus/src/Pegasus/Config/ConfigManager.cpp
220 pegasus/src/Pegasus/Config/FileSystemPropertyOwner.h
221 pegasus/src/Pegasus/Config/FileSystemPropertyOwner.cpp
222
223 4. KS - 18 Feb 02 Add changes to test for and set the NULL value for CIMValues.
|
224 karl 1.62 This forces new CIMValues to have a NULL attributes that is only
225 reset when a value is "set" or copied into them. the XML and MOF
226 also deliver a NULL value back when the state of the CIMValue is NULL.
227 There is a remaining addition to put an exception on CIMValue gets when
228 the NULL attribute is set that we will install later.
|
229 karl 1.63
|
230 kumpf 1.67 5. KS - 19 Feb 2002 Extended testclient slightly and cleaned up numerous bugs.
|
231 karl 1.62
|
232 kumpf 1.67 6. KS - 19 Feb 2002 - Add workpaper in doc/workpaper defining the Pegasus Qualifiers.
|
233 karl 1.64 Note that this version of the paper still needs work.
234
|
235 kumpf 1.67 7. (Nag Boranna - HP) 20 Feb 2002 - Modified HTTPAcceptor to optionally bind to
|
236 kumpf 1.65 loopback host. Modified CIMClient to connect to loopback host when connectLocal()
237 method is used. Added a new method lookupPort() in System.h to return the system
238 configured wbem port number. Modified cimuser, cimauth and cimconfig CLI's to use
239 modified CIMClient connectLocal() interface.
240
|
241 kumpf 1.67 8. (KS- 21 Feb 2002) - Modified Makefile for repository load so located in
|
242 karl 1.66 schema directory. The one in src/pegasus/compiler/load is deprecated and
243 will be deleted.
244
|
245 kumpf 1.67 9. KS-21 Feb 2002 - Added new constructor to CIMValue and associated tests
246
247 10. RK-20 Feb 2002 - Add Array reference to CIMValue and added tests
|
248 karl 1.66
|
249 kumpf 1.67 11. (Sushma Fernandes - HP, Nag Boranna - HP) 22 Feb 2002 Implemented
250 checks for privileged user when performing authorization.
251 Added a configuration property enableRemotePrivilegedUserAccess.
252 This property needs to be set to true to enable privileged user access
253 for remote clients.
|
254 karl 1.66
|
255 kumpf 1.68 12. (Roger Kumpf - HP) 22 Feb 2002 - Added type information to extrinsic
256 method (InvokeMethod) operations. This change involves the addition
257 of PARAMTYPE attributes to PARAMVALUE and RETURNVALUE tags. This tag
258 allows the server to determine the type of a parameter value without
259 having to look up the method definition in the schema. It also allows
260 the client API to do the same for output parameters as well as return

371 kumpf 1.75 19. (Roger Kumpf - HP) 1 Mar 2002 - Reworked the XmlWriter class to
372 eliminate many of the redundant memory copies that resulted from the
373 nested method call structure. Now, instead of having a method at
374 each level that adds a begin tag, contents, and an end tag, there
375 are separate methods to add the begin and end tags. At the top
376 level, each of the begin tag methods are called, then the message
377 "body" is added, followed by calls to the end tag methods.
378
379 The message body is currently still copied twice, once into the XML
380 payload and then again when the HTTP header is added. (Since the
381 HTTP header contains a content length field, the header cannot be
382 constructed until the payload is complete.) It is possible to
383 remove these extra copies as well, but that would require additional
384 changes elsewhere in the code. For example, the HTTPMessage class
385 would need to hold the headers and payload separately rather than in
386 a single buffer.
387
388 Along with these changes, I did a lot of cleanup. Much of the XML
389 formatting code has been moved from CIMReference to XmlWriter. Also,
390 error message formatting has been consolidated in XmlWriter from the
391 various encoders and decoders, etc.

815 35. (Roger Kumpf - HP) 30 Oct 2001 - Association classes have keys
816 whose types are references. These reference values must be
817 treated specially in the XML encoding, using the VALUE.REFERENCE
818 tag structure.
819
820 Pegasus had been passing reference values simply as String values.
821 For example, EnumerateInstanceNames returned KEYVALUEs of string
822 type rather than VALUE.REFERENCEs.
823
824 I've modified the XmlReader::getKeyBindingElement() and
825 CIMReference::instanceNameToXml() methods to read and write the
826 XML in the proper format. However, making that change required
827 mike 1.51 that a CIMReference object be able to distinguish between a key
828 of String type and a key of reference type.
829
830 I've modified the String format of CIMReferences slightly to
831 allow efficient processing of references whose keys are also of
832 reference type. The "official" form uses the same encoding for
833 key values of String type and of reference type, and so it
834 would be necessary to retrieve the class definition and look up
835 the types of the key properties to determine how to treat the
836 key values. This is clearly too inefficient for internal
837 transformations between CIMReferences and String values.
838
839 The workaround is to encode a 'R' at the beginning of the value
840 for a key of reference type (before the opening '"'). This allows
841 the parser to know a priori whether the key is of String or
842 reference type.
843
844 In this example:
845
846 MyClass.Key1="StringValue",Key2=R"RefClass.KeyA="StringA",KeyB=10"
847
848 mike 1.51 Property Key1 of class MyClass is of String type, and so it gets
849 the usual encoding. Key2 is a reference property, so the extra 'R'
850 is inserted before its encoded value. Note that this algorithm is
851 recursive, such that RefClass could include KeyC of reference type,
852 which would also get encoded with the 'R' notation.
853
854 The toString() method inserts the 'R' to provide symmetry. A new
855 KeyBinding type (REFERENCE) has been defined to denote keys in a
856 CIMReference that are of reference type. This KeyBinding type must
857 be used appropriately for CIMReference::ttoString() to behave
858 correctly.
859
860 The files that have been modified to make this change are
861 CIMReference.h, CIMReference.cpp, and CIMInstanceRep.cpp.
862
863 A result of this change is that instances names in the instance
864 repository will include this extra 'R' character. Thus, you will
865 need to repopulate your repository when you download the latest
866 CIMOM version.
867
868 Note that for user-facing uses of the String encoding of instance
869 mike 1.51 names (such as might appear in MOF for static association
870 instances or in the CGI client), this solution is non-standard and
871 therefore unacceptable. It is likely that these points will need
872 to process the more expensive operation of retrieving the class
873 definition to determine the key property types.

899 41. (Roger Kumpf - HP) 14 Nov 2001 - Changed the behavior of the CIMValue
900 toString() method for CIMValues of String type. The old behavior
901 returned an XML encoding of the String with special characters
902 replaced by their UTF-8 equivalents. For example, a CIMValue of a"b
903 would be returned as a"b. The new behavior just returns the
904 String value directly with no translation. (Note that
905 CIMValue.toXml() may still be used to get the XML-encoded value.)
906
907 This change was necessary in part to correct the behavior of the
908 repository. CreateInstance stores the instance name returned by
909 CIMInstance.getInstanceName(), which is built using calls to
910 CIMValue.toString(). GetInstance searches for the instance name
911 mike 1.51 without UTF-8 encoding of special characters. For GetInstance to
912 be successful, CreateInstance must have stored the instance name
913 in that same form, without special character encoding.
